They donated a special Bed Sack, that rolls out into a sleeping bag that you can crawl into from the top. It’s like a backpack that can be carried on your back with the attached ties. It’s also quite thick and will help keep someone warm for sure!

Interested in how to make one? If so, they found the directions on how to make the quilt from ‘The Sleeping Bag project’ at: http://www.thesleepingbagproject.org/
